One of Santa Barbara’s most revered properties, this prominent and beautiful 4000+SF Colonial Revival estate rests proudly at the gateway to Santa Barbara’s prestigious Upper East neighborhood. The ideal central location is only 3-5 blocks to the Theater/Arts District’s restaurants and culture, and a half-block to Alice Keck Park Gardens. The home has recently been restored and expanded, with wonderful new additions to the floorplan, including a downstairs 2nd primary bedroom suite, and a fully-entitled separate-entrance 1-bedroom apartment above a new 3-car garage. The large nearly 1/2 acre parcel has an undeveloped section at the north end, which combined with beneficial R-M zoning provides added underlying value in development potential, or to expand the beautiful gardens.
